Información Importante
El 26 de junio entrará en vigor la medida, que obliga a los extranjeros abajo mencionados a ingresar a los Estados Unidos con pasaporte electrónico o, en su defecto, visado. Las transportadoras que violen la medida serán multadas con USD 3.300 por pasajero.
Integran el referido programa 27 naciones: Alemania, Andorra, Australia, Austria, Bélgica, Brunei, Dinamarca, Eslovenia, España, Finlandia, Francia, Holanda, Inglaterra, Islandia, Irlanda, Italia, Japón, Lichtenstein, Luxemburgo, Mónaco, Nueva Zelanda, Noruega, Portugal, San Marino, Singapur, Suecia y Suiza.
Si Usted es nacional de alguno de los anteriores países y reside en Colombia, debe ir a su embajada a realizar al cambio de pasaporte.

sandramoreno80 says on Jun 22, 2005, 14:17: Yeah it is true, your passport must be machine readable ie. it must have 2 lines of numbers, letters and symbols at the bottom of the personal details page, which will transfer the data when the entry agent swipes the passport. This has been around for a while now in the UK, though there are some old passports around and they have to get a visa from the embassy in London if they want to go to to the US or just change their passport for a new one.
